diff options
author | greta <gretadoci@gmail.com> | 2022-08-01 19:17:50 +0200 |
---|---|---|
committer | greta <gretadoci@gmail.com> | 2022-08-02 15:50:06 +0200 |
commit | 0bb87fa43f96070dcbbb9ba30aafb7b90eb70735 (patch) | |
tree | ea8f587fded040b0d2f6e66b1492f3974e497aef /src/components/MembersList | |
parent | 32a95ee9eb888f78abe3ae2755041abb74fbc8c2 (diff) |
Migrate leftover icons
Signed-off-by: greta <gretadoci@gmail.com>
Diffstat (limited to 'src/components/MembersList')
-rw-r--r-- | src/components/MembersList/MembersListItem.vue | 19 |
1 files changed, 16 insertions, 3 deletions
diff --git a/src/components/MembersList/MembersListItem.vue b/src/components/MembersList/MembersListItem.vue index 329f2d84..cb2145c7 100644 --- a/src/components/MembersList/MembersListItem.vue +++ b/src/components/MembersList/MembersListItem.vue @@ -38,15 +38,19 @@ <template v-if="!loading && isPendingApproval && circle.canManageMembers"> <Actions> <ActionButton - icon="icon-checkmark" @click="acceptMember"> + <template #icon> + <IconCheck :size="20" /> + </template> {{ t('contacts', 'Accept membership request') }} </ActionButton> </Actions> <Actions> <ActionButton - icon="icon-close" @click="deleteMember"> + <template #icon> + <IconClose :size="20" /> + </template> {{ t('contacts', 'Reject membership request') }} </ActionButton> </Actions> @@ -85,7 +89,10 @@ :size="16" decorative /> </ActionButton> - <ActionButton v-else-if="canDelete" icon="icon-delete" @click="deleteMember"> + <ActionButton v-else-if="canDelete" @click="deleteMember"> + <template #icon> + <IconDelete :size="20" /> + </template> {{ t('contacts', 'Remove member') }} </ActionButton> </template> @@ -101,6 +108,9 @@ import ListItemIcon from '@nextcloud/vue/dist/Components/ListItemIcon' import ActionSeparator from '@nextcloud/vue/dist/Components/ActionSeparator' import ActionButton from '@nextcloud/vue/dist/Components/ActionButton' import ActionText from '@nextcloud/vue/dist/Components/ActionText' +import IconDelete from 'vue-material-design-icons/Delete' +import IconCheck from 'vue-material-design-icons/Check' +import IconClose from 'vue-material-design-icons/Close' import ExitToApp from 'vue-material-design-icons/ExitToApp' import ShieldCheck from 'vue-material-design-icons/ShieldCheck' @@ -117,6 +127,9 @@ export default { ActionButton, ActionSeparator, ActionText, + IconDelete, + IconCheck, + IconClose, ExitToApp, ListItemIcon, ShieldCheck, |